Description
Betts-96 in silver is another variety within the Vigo Bay medal series, commemorating the Anglo-Dutch naval triumph of October 1702. Each Betts number in the Vigo Bay group (93-101) represents a distinct medal design, and Betts-96 features its own unique combination of obverse and reverse imagery relating to the battle. The action at Vigo Bay was remarkable for its audacity -- the allied fleet had to force its way past shore batteries and a heavy boom chain to reach the Franco-Spanish ships anchored within the protected harbor. The complete destruction or capture of the enemy fleet, including treasure ships returning from the Americas, electrified both England and the Netherlands. This silver striking represents a premium version of the Betts-96 design, produced in smaller numbers than bronze and commanding higher collector interest. The variety of medal designs produced for Vigo Bay reflects the battle's enormous propaganda value for the Anglo-Dutch alliance in the opening year of the War of the Spanish Succession.
